Specifications

  • Input Voltage Range: 2.7V - 5.5V
  • Output Voltage: 3.3V
  • Maximum Output Current: 1.5A
  • Dropout Voltage: 200mV (typical)
  • Operating Temperature Range: -40°C to +85°C

Detailed Pin Configuration

PAM3115CLA330 features the following pin configuration:

  1. VIN: Input voltage pin
  2. GND: Ground pin
  3. EN: Enable pin
  4. FB: Feedback pin
  5. VOUT: Output voltage pin

Working Principles

PAM3115CLA330 operates based on the principle of switching voltage regulation. It utilizes an internal control circuitry to maintain a constant output voltage, regardless of variations in input voltage or load conditions. This is achieved through a feedback mechanism that continuously adjusts the duty cycle of the internal switch, ensuring the desired output voltage is maintained.
